The Pascal Engman Foundation promotes reading among the young

In February 2021, the author launched his Swedish foundation Pascal Engmans stiftelse. The foundation is dedicated to the cause of promoting reading among young people. Since reading is decreasing in the population as a whole, and in particular among young age groups, Pascal Engman has established the foundation, with an annual prize being awarded to someone — could be a librarian, teacher or a book blogger, or someone else — who has done significant impact to get more young people to read.

The recipient of the annual award, named Reading Promoter of the Year, receives a 2,500 EUR grant.

Pascal Engmans stiftelse was announced through an op-ed in Sweden's #1 morning paper Dagens Nyheter. The launch of the foundation was widely covered in Swedish national news media and put significant light on the issue.
